Can we use a review for eligibility as part of an onboarding programme and onboarding wizard? We currently use the Extended ILR section and generated document as our eligibility document - can we use a review instead? Or would the prospective apprentice have to complete the onboarding wizard and then we pull what we want from there into a custom review? Would learners have to log in again to sign the review?
The learner will, through the ILR and extended ILR step, be signing to confirm the data that they have provided. Yes we would advise the use of an eligibility review that you as a provider custom create against the eligibility programme and complete to confirm (using data provided by the learner in onboarding) that all eligibility criteria have been met. This can then be signed internally and retained by you against the learner record. You can also attach the extended ILR to the onboarding step of the delivery programme so the learner can re-check and sign the information that they have provided following your eligibility checks, in case some data has been amended during the process (e.g. where additional information or clarifications have been requested and provided).
Is there a report that can be used to generate a list of reviews that have not been signed?
The 'Signatures' page in the new Console view gives you a list of all of the Reviews that require your signature as an organisation. This is dependent on the group access that you have assigned the user. We are further enhancing this view to show which signatures have been obtained and are still outstanding. No confirmed date for this change at present.
Regarding the missing signatures, yes you can see the list of signatures missing but cannot export/download the data.
This is correct. There is no CSV export option.
Does the functional skills exemption get carried across to the learning plan as well?
Learning plan components are not directly connected to this exemption status. We recommend using sub-programmes for your functional skills, so that where an exemption applies, that sub-programme would not be added and therefore any learning plan components for the functional skills would not be included on the learners plan.
